The Games (film)

''The Games'' is a 1970 film based on the Hugh Atkinson novel and adapted to the screen by Erich Segal. It was directed by Michael Winner.
The plot concerned four marathon competitors at a fictitious Olympic Games in Rome, played by Michael Crawford, Ryan O'Neal, Charles Aznavour, and Athol Compton. Elton John recorded one song ('From Denver To L.A.') for the soundtrack.
To simulate vast crowds of people, thousands of life-sized dummies were placed in the stadium's seats.
==Cast==

* Michael Crawford as Harry Hayes, British competitor
* Ryan O'Neal as Scott Reynolds, American competitor
* Charles Aznavour as Pavel Vendek, Czech competitor
* Jeremy Kemp as Jim Harcourt
* Elaine Taylor as Christine
* Stanley Baker as Bill Oliver
* Athol Compton as Sunny Pintubi, Australian competitor
* Rafer Johnson as Commentator
* Kent Smith as Kaverley
* Sam Elliott as Richie Robinson
* Mona Washbourne as Mrs. Hayes
* Reg Lye as Gilmour
* June Jago as Mae Harcourt
* Don Newsome as Cal Wood
